According to a prominent weather expert, RIYADH – The 40-day Al-Murabaniyah, or the season of biting cold, is expected to begin in Saudi Arabia on Dec. 7 and will continue until Jan. 14.

Abdul Aziz Al-Hussaini, a weather researcher and climate scientist, stated that the 40-day Al-Murabaniyah will begin this year on Dec. 7 (Jamad Al-Awwal 3, 1443), which is the date of the actual beginning of the winter season, and will end on Jan. 14, 2022 (Jamad Al-Akher 11).

Speaking to Al-Arabiya.net, Al-Hussaini said that the actual beginning of the astronomical winter in the northern hemisphere is from Dec. 21 (Jamad Al-Awwal 17).

Al-Murabaniyah Winter

Al-Murabaniyah, which begins with Winter Solstice, is a period of intense cold that lasts 40 days. Specifically, it is the period extending from Dec. 22 to Jan. 31. This Saudi winter is severe and with the chances of frequent snowfall. The weather remains the coldest during this period, with the daytime temperatures dipping drastically.

Al-Hussaini said the winter days would see the earliest start to noon prayer during the year when the sun heads toward the south on its way to the Tropic of Capricorn, which means the shortest day time and the longest night time. The temperatures decrease due to the shorter stay of the sun, he said.
